The Atami area is a famous hot spring resort city on the coast of Shizuoka Prefecture, renowned for its scenic beauty and therapeutic waters. An interesting fact is that Atami's name literally means "hot ocean," derived from the hot springs that flow into the sea. The city is a popular destination for both domestic and international tourists. The closest major landmark is the iconic Atami Castle, a modern reconstruction offering panoramic views of Sagami Bay and the city, blending historical aesthetics with a museum and observation decks.
